<p><em style=background-color: rgba(246 242 238 1); color: rgba(0 0 0 1)>Fidida Fidida (This and That): Growing Up Garifuna and Belizean</em><span style=background-color: rgba(246 242 238 1); color: rgba(0 0 0 1)>&nbsp;is a poetic tribute to the resilience beauty and cultural richness of the Garifuna people. Harriet Arzu Scarborough a native of Barranco Belize and a longtime resident of Tucson Arizona shares forty-five poems that journey from ancestral origins to modern life capturing the spirit of a people often overlooked in history books.</span></p><p><span style=background-color: rgba(246 242 238 1); color: rgba(0 0 0 1)>Organized into five thematic sections this collection offers insights into Garifuna identity daily life love migration and memory. With accessible language and heartfelt reflection Scarborough invites both Garifuna youth and curious readers worldwide to explore a culture shaped by survival strength and deep connection to land and heritage.</span></p><p><span style=background-color: rgba(246 242 238 1); color: rgba(0 0 0 1)>For those unfamiliar with the Garinagu this book offers a rare illuminating entry point. For those who carry the culture in their blood it is a mirror-one that honors their past and speaks to their future with warmth honesty and grace.</span></p>
